Article summary:

1. This article discusses the potential of using Vehicle-to-Grid (V2G) technology to reduce energy costs and CO2 emissions in microgrids.

2. The article proposes a model that combines V2G with renewable energy sources and electric vehicles, and uses decision matrix methods to convert multi-objective functions into a single comprehensive objective.

3. Algorithms such as particle swarm optimization and artificial bee colony are applied to various operational and control strategies, and simulations are used to validate the proposed model.
